Warning Signs You Need Truck-Mounted Water Extraction
Water damage can be sneaky, and it’s often not until it’s too late that you realize you have a problem. But here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Showing Hidden Moisture: If you notice a musty odor in your home that won’t go away, it’s a sign that there’s hidden moisture present. This can lead to mold growth and further damage if left unchecked.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Sign of Water Damage: If your floors are warped or buckled, it’s a sign that there’s been water damage. This can be due to a variety of reasons, including a burst pipe or a sewage backup.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Sign of Leaks: If you notice water stains on your ceiling, it’s a sign that there’s a leak somewhere in your home. This can be due to a variety of reasons, including a roof leak or a plumbing issue.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Showing Moisture Issues: If you notice unexplained mold growth in your home, it’s a sign that there’s a moisture issue present. This can lead to further damage and health problems if left unchecked.
Water Damage in Your Attic
Sign of Roof Leaks: If you notice water damage in your attic, it’s a sign that there’s a roof leak present. This can lead to further damage and costly repairs if left unchecked.
Water Damage in Your Basement
Sign of Foundation Issues: If you notice water damage in your basement, it’s a sign that there’s a foundation issue present. This can lead to further damage and costly repairs if left unchecked.
Truck-Mounted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 1 inch of water) |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small spills, but be sure to clean and dry the area quickly to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e (more than 1 inch of water) | No | Yes | For larger water damage, it’s best to call a professional to ensure the job is done right and to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age from a sewage backup | No | Yes | Sewage backups need specialized equipment and expertise to clean and disinfect the area safely. |
| Water damage in your attic or crawl space | No | Yes | Attics and crawl spaces need specialized equipment and expertise to access and clean safely. |
| Water damage with hidden moisture issues | No | Yes | Hidden moisture issues need specialized equipment and expertise to detect and resolve safely. |

Truck-Mounted Water Extraction Cost in Bremerton, WA
The cost of Truck-Mounted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Bremerton, WA.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500, but the final cost will depend on the specifics of your situ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$1,500 | Severity of damage, type of equ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Severity of damage, type of equipment needed |
| Final Inspection and Clean-Up |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, type of equipment needed |
